creative bioarray - Alkaline Phosphatase Staining
Alkaline phosphatase (AP) staining is a rapid method for screening pluripotent cells by using AP activity. AP is a hydrolase responsible for the dephosphorylation of many molecules, such as nucleotides, proteins, and alkaloids under alkaline conditions. AP activity is higher in pluripotent cells but is greatly decreased in more differentiated cell types. The technique described herein may be used to enumerate pluripotent cells during differentiation in the presence or absence of specific genetic manipulations or small chemical modulators. Pericytes are vascular mural cells embedded in the basement membrane of blood microvessels. They extend their processes along capillaries, pre-capillary arterioles and post-capillary venules. Pericytes regulate blood-brain barrier (BBB) permeability, angiogenesis, clearance, cerebral blood flow (CBF), neuroinflammation and stem cell activity.creative bioarray - Pooled Human Hepatocytes
Pooled Human Hepatocytes are the chief functional cells of the liver, responsible for the selective uptake, metabolism and excretion of most drugs. Cells for use in plate cultures or suspension assays represent a key tool for predicting properties such as hepatotoxicity, metabolism, and potential drug-drug interactions. Since these cells mimic the properties of the liver, researchers can evaluate the metabolism, drug-drug interaction and toxicity of drug candidates in a cost-effective manner.creative bioarray - Establishment and Culture Protocol of mESCs Cell Lines
Embryonic stem cells (ESCs) are abbreviated as ES, EK, or ESC cells. They are a class of cells isolated from early embryos (before the proto-intestinal stage) or primitive gonads, which have the properties of unlimited proliferation, self-renewal and multidirectional differentiation in vitro in culture. ES cells can be induced to differentiate into almost all cell types of the organism, both in vitro and in vivo environments.ADME and Pharmacokinetic Services

ADME is short for "absorption, distribution, metabolism, and excretion". The four properties determine the drug level within a body, the drug exposure to tissues, and the metabolic process of a compound, which can help predict the bioavailability and bioactivity of a drug-whether a drug can reach its intended target and confer a therapeutic effect. Therefore, understanding the ADME properties of the compounds is crucial to the drug developing process.
